> In CF Admin there is a 'Long Text Buffer (chr)' under advanced settings.
>
> Somehow all of my databases got set to 0 when the default is 64,000.
> Check your setting.

> > I'm building a proof-of-concept CMS using CF MX Enterprise and an
> Access
> > 2000 database on Windows 2000 using the MS Access ODBC Driver.
> >
> > I have two memo fields because they contain larger amounts of text;
> when
> > the data type is memo, the text in that column does not display.
> However,
> > if I change the data type to test, the text from that column displays
> just
> > fine.  Nothing else has changed other than changing the field type in
> > Access.
> >
> > Has anyone seen this?  Is this a bug?
